Use logarithms to solve the equation {{{5^x = 2^(2x+1)}}}
the log equiv of exponents
{{{xlog(5) = (2x+1)log((2)))}}}
find the log of  5 and 2
.699x = .301(2x+1)
.699x = .602x + .301
.699x - .602x = .301
.097x = .301
x = {{{.301/.097}}}
x = 3.103
